Output ecfe70bcd5f0d69fc9353be36423322c3061e3f6a74e96e19f6d6d5a180a52af:4

value
68957
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ff1ca828f18c6a5d7dbd4cc5dff28aabd6cbb2c6 OP_EQUAL
address
3QwvZaJogZSyU8c595SuFj4dSgQnMq1ejf
transaction
ecfe70bcd5f0d69fc9353be36423322c3061e3f6a74e96e19f6d6d5a180a52af
confirmations
60435
spent
true